#3464e8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3464e8 is composed of 20.4% red, 39.2% green and 91%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 77.6% cyan, 56.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 224 degrees, a saturation of 79.6% and a lightness of 55.7%. #3464e8 color hex could be obtained by blending #68c8ff with #0000d1. Closest websafe color is: #3366ff.

#3464e8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3464e8 has RGB values of R:52, G:100, B:232 and CMYK values of C:0.78, M:0.57, Y:0,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 3433704.

Shades and Tints of #3464e8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010308 is the darkest color, while #f6f8f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#3464e8
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8b8d91 is the less saturated color, while #235cf9 is the most saturated one.
